Dr. Naaborle Sackeyfio Joins AITA’s Advisory Board

Washington, D.C. (PRUnderground) March 12th, 2014

The Advancing Investments & Trade in Africa (“AITA”) is pleased to announce that Dr. Naaborle Sackeyfio has been appointed to serve on the Advisory Board of AITA, a nonprofit organization dedicated to increasing sustainable development in Africa.

Dr. Sackeyfio is an Assistant Professor at the School of Diplomacy and International Relations, Seton Hall University.  She has previously taught at New York University, Marymount Manhattan College, Queens College, and Rutgers University.

During her doctoral studies, Dr. Sackeyfio received various awards for her research on Africa and has taught several courses on African Political Economy, Comparative Political Development, and International Relations.  She earned both her Master’s and Ph.D. in Political Science from the City University of New York and also holds an M.A. in Diplomacy and International Relations from Seton Hall.

“AITA is extremely pleased to welcome Dr. Sackeyfio to our Advisory Board.  Dr. Sackeyfio has dedicated her career researching Africa’s Political Economy.  Over the course of her career, Dr. Sackeyfio has demonstrated the talent and leadership that AITA needs to implement our mission.  We look forward to her counsel as AITA seeks to increase sustainable investments and trade in Africa.  Her expertise as a Political Scientist with an interest in Africa’s economic development will be very valuable to AITA,” said Adjoa Linzy, Esquire, Founder & Board Chair of AITA.

On her new advisory role, Dr. Sackeyfio commented, “with some of the fastest growing economies located on the African continent, AITA is well suited to the task of exploring a new paradigm for investment.  As a timely organization, AITA’s mission promises to offer myriad opportunities that illuminate the prospects for growth, sustainable development and investment.  Owing to what I view as substantive engagement with trade and investment opportunities, I am pleased to contribute to AITA’s objectives by transforming perceptions about Africa’s economic trajectory.”

About AITA

AITA is an international trade nonprofit based in Washington, D.C., with regional representatives in Ghana, United States, France, and Canada.  AITA was organized exclusively for charitable and educational purposes. The group tailors its uniqueness as one of the few organizations that links outside business, development, and trade to a wide variety of investment opportunities on the African continent.
